Output 77b7b009654c8bb804d57f2d49baf69ea59c02926b36711776f96e9555285853:5

value
438460383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83300314736e19c9d5bf8738e3cd553d5fae85b5 OP_EQUAL
address
3DefxcDJYQ2c26bZAP8g15t9S1q7rgXKLF
transaction
77b7b009654c8bb804d57f2d49baf69ea59c02926b36711776f96e9555285853
spent
true